Output 314d110a1cae9616362b3a57717566f96a6ad988164ed9497d8c885607d7e833:1

value
117486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7af4ff125298cc1b79f49993a2d7985bcbce51d2 OP_EQUALVERIFY OP_CHECKSIG
address
1CD8w3tPFFjT8FSRRVswwMPSKJTyq1wLHu
transaction
314d110a1cae9616362b3a57717566f96a6ad988164ed9497d8c885607d7e833
confirmations
526669
spent
true